Output 87269c7a63bdf6ab218553453142058a4df58ccfcec0dc58fa02a84bf4fc4dd5:0

value
156436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fca435225d5529e03cd328f41793365e1d1b6424 OP_EQUAL
address
3QirvE4XVEfoLfCSdFSFmkrtuwX82bgTXo
transaction
87269c7a63bdf6ab218553453142058a4df58ccfcec0dc58fa02a84bf4fc4dd5
spent
true